Rear View Mirror display
I have an 2006 E53 4.4i. The rear view mirror displays direction. Since I have a NAV, that direction is useless so I want the rear view mirror to display external temprature or something else..I can see that by shining a light at the led display it is capable of displaying other things such as temp etc..but haven't found any controls to make it work. Another question..has any one figured out if you replace the cassette deck behind the NAV with a single CD player or changer...I know about the trunk changer and all the details. I am talking about replacing the cassette with the CD player/changer behind the NAV. Judd. |
